Replacing basic auth for IMAP with OAuth 2.0 in an unattended application
Hi, We have an automated process that reads incoming emails and extract attachments from an O365 inbox which has IMAP basic auth enabled. The org wants to disable basic auth and have us use eithe...

I am by no means a developer but i have somewhat heard about the question you raised. Oauth 2.0 does support authentication against office 365 services without user intervention. To start off you will have to register the application in azure and retrieve a 'client id' and 'client secret' which you can later use in the code for obtaining a token.
